Song of Grazing

Farming is an unending procession of work. Little of our work on this farm is mechanized. Our horses are our tractors and we pitch manure one fork at a time. While chores are extended, it affords us the solitude to eavesdrop on the life around us. A House Wren boldly churrs and scolds intruders near […]
